Global automotive brake valve market is projected to witness a CAGR of 5.45% during the forecast period 2025-2032, growing from USD 4.32 billion in 2024 to USD 6.60 billion in 2032, as modern vehicles demand precise and reliable braking systems. As safety regulations get tighter and customers demand smoother driving experiences, brake valves are evolving with advanced technology. Manufacturers are investing in better materials and electronic control integration to meet these changing dynamics. The market rides alongside the growing vehicle parc and the push for performance efficiency. From luxury cars to rugged trucks, brake valves are becoming indispensable heroes behind the scenes.
Furthermore, brake valves improve braking efficiency by reducing driver effort and enhancing safety. Their adoption is fueling growth and innovation in the brake valve market as demand for advanced braking systems rises.
For instance, in October 2022, Safim S.p.A. introduced its new EH series of brake valves, EH-S6O, EH-S6E, and EH-S6T, at the Bauma exhibition. These advanced valves are designed for off-highway and agricultural vehicles, offering improved performance with lower hysteresis, high repeatability, and faster response times. The series supports integration with ECUs, sensors, and software, meeting the latest ISO safety standards and enabling intelligent, automated braking systems for enhanced vehicle safety and control.
Regulations to Fuel the Automotive Brake Valve Market Demand
Governments across the world are tightening road safety norms, pushing automakers to adopt advanced braking technologies. Brake valves, being the core component of the brake system, are benefiting from this trend. As customers expect vehicles to stop smoothly in any situation, manufacturers are attributing significant R&D budgets to develop valves with faster response times and higher durability. This regulatory push is likely to keep the demand curve for brake valves steady for years.
For instance, in March 2025, the Indian government announced that, from April 2026, all new large passenger vehicles, including buses and trucks, must be equipped with advanced emergency braking systems (AEBS). This move, part of amendments to the Central Motor Vehicles Rules, aims to enhance road safety by automatically applying brakes if drivers fail to respond to potential collisions. The mandate will extend to existing models manufactured from October 2026
In emergency braking, brake valves play a critical role in controlling air pressure to the brake chambers, ensuring rapid and effective braking. They regulate the flow of compressed air, allowing for quick brake application and release, and some valves also balance brake pressure to prevent wheel lock-up, enhancing stability. EV Boom and Aftermarket Growth to Shape Automotive Brake Valve Market Dynamics
The electric vehicle boom is impacting the automotive brake valve market. While EVs are quieter and greener, they demand brake valves that can seamlessly integrate with regenerative braking systems. So, brake valve makers are tweaking designs to fit new-age architectures. As more drivers shift gears toward EVs, manufacturers are anticipated to grab this chance to supply smart, efficient valves that complement the electric drivetrain's unique demands.
For instance, in December 2023, Knorr-Bremse AG launched the latest iTEBS X electronic trailer braking system. It features an integrated lift axle valve that automates axle lifting based on load, reducing complexity and costs. The system also includes a combined parking and maneuvering valve, which simplifies brake and suspension controls, enhancing safety and ease of use.
Aging vehicles and the thriving aftermarket sector are significantly impacting the brake valve market. In regions where older vehicles are high in numbers, periodic replacement of brake system parts is non-negotiable for safety. This expands opportunities for third-party manufacturers and local suppliers to cater to cost-conscious consumers. The growing vehicle fleet, especially in Asia-Pacific and South America, is likely to attract more players into this segment, keeping the supply chain dynamic and competitive.

Impact of the United States Tariffs on the Automotive Brake Valve Market
US tariffs on imported automotive parts have impacted global supply chains, and brake valve suppliers are affected the most. Higher import costs have pushed manufacturers to localize production or source materials domestically.
Some players are passing costs to OEMs, who in turn adjust prices for end customers.
However, the tariffs are also catalyzing fresh investments in North American manufacturing clusters. While margins have tightened, the race to secure stable supply chains has made local partnerships and nearshoring more attractive.

For instance, in March 2023, ZF Friedrichshafen AG introduced an advanced brake-by-wire solution for the global construction industry. Central to this system is the electrohydraulic brake valve, which enables precise brake control by adjusting brake pressure electronically, eliminating the need for traditional hydraulic lines in the cab. This innovation not only simplifies installation but also allows for customizable brake feel, supporting the transition to electric and autonomous off-highway vehicles.
